A follow up to a query of a few months ago.

The PPM or DPMO project the SMART Group has been running since May is now on
line at www.ppm-monitoring.com or if you like www.dpmo-monitoring.com. The
SMART Group launched the site at Nepcon Electronics this week with support
from the DTI, Department of Trade and Industry. We are looking to increase
the number of contributing companies to the project and hope we can continue
to work with IPC, NEMI, SMTA and other industry group for the common good of
our industry.

Jack Crawford queried the use of the term "PPM", but rest assured that the
numbers are DPMO as per IPC-7912. There are some overview stats on the site
available to all (how do you compare?!), and more detailed numbers available
to companies participating. Obviously, the more companies submitting data
(all confidential), the more meaningful the stats will be.

  One of our Quality Managers has asked me to quiz the TechNet for
information on solder defect rates. We think we are pretty good and want to
compare against others in the industry. He has asked for rates for hand
soldering and also machine (automatic) soldering. We deal in two basic
product lines; IR products and Space/Communications.

  Any information regarding solder defect rates in the hand soldering and or
automatic soldering areas would be appreciated.
